Kenya’s Telecom Regulator to Hike Satellite ISP Licensing Fees by Over 800%

Kenya’s Communications Authority (CA) has proposed a dramatic increase in the licensing fees for satellite Internet providers (ISPs), potentially reshaping the digital landscape in one of Africa’s most tech-forward nations. Indonesia Upholds iPhone 16 Sales Ban Despite Apple’s $1 Billion Investment Offer

Indonesia has reaffirmed its ban on iPhone 16 sales, maintaining its stance despite Apple’s offer to invest $1 billion in the country. The ban, originally implemented in October 2024, arose from Apple’s failure to comply with Indonesia’s stringent local investment requirements, which mandate that 40% of smartphone components be locally sourced. Kenya Leads Africa in Start-Up Funding for 2024 Amid Global Economic Challenges

Kenya has emerged as Africa’s leader in start-up funding for 2024, securing a substantial share of the continent’s venture capital (VC) investments. Despite a global funding slowdown and challenging economic conditions, Kenya’s start-up ecosystem demonstrated resilience, attracting $638 million (Ksh.82.5 billion) in equity, debt, and grants—29% of all funding raised across Africa.
